Chapter 74: Voices 

***Christian*** 

..A few hours earlier...

I haven’t slept at all since Chaos made me a living compass, the voices in my head whispering and muttering non-stop in Jack’s absence.

Their incessant murmuring has led me all the way to California and now as morning breaks over the horizon, I find myself driving out of San Rafael through a dense forest.

"Turn here! No, there! Take a left, you i***t!", The voices hiss.

They are driving me insane! 

"Your mind wandered before us!"

A voicesnaps.

"You ungrateful mutt!"

My phone rings beside me, the screen flashing with my father’s name.He hasn’t stopped calling me all night and this morning.

"You miss your mommy?" Avoice snickers.

"She wasa stupid b***h for having you!"

"Shut up!" I shout, nearly swerving into another lane in anger.

"Aww you're going to protect her now, after all you've done to her?’ Another sneers.

"Mommy killer!"

The other voices begin to chant in unison, "Mommy Killer! Mommy Killer! Mommy Killer!"

"Shut up..." I murmur, scratching at my head to make them stop.

"I said shut up!"

I pull over down a secluded road and step out to catch my breath, counting each exhale until the voices stop.

Get it together...

I scold myself.

You have a mission to accomplish.

My phone begins to ring again and I hang up, scrolling through the messages left by my father.

WHERE ARE YOU?? PICK UP YOUR PHONE! HAVE YOU SEEN YOUR MOTHER?? I CAN’T FEEL HER! CHRISTIAN!!! I feel sick as I read through his desperation but I close his messages and check my recent messages for any updates from Brody, the spy I sent to watch Jordan.

That’s odd, I mutter.He hasn't messaged me any new updates in over 12 hrs.

"Traitor! He’s a traitor!" the voices hiss.

"The Killer has a traitor!" They shriek with laughter.

"He's got a target on his back! Who else will betray him?"

I climb back into the car, hoping to outrun these voices, but they follow me wherever I turn.

By the time I make it to the City where this River Moon Pack is located, I’m almost on the verge of tears with frustration.

"The Mall! The Mall!" The voices whisper.

"The boy will be at the Mall.He wears the medallion! Wait by the fountain at noon! Go!"

I drive to the mall, rushing in towards the restroom to clean myself up and prepare my tools for my mission.

The witches had given me a sleeping potion and I spray it on a cloth and some candy before heading to the fountain.

The Mall is crowded and without my wolf, I cannot smell Natalia, much less our pup.

The voices urge me to stay put and despite my impatience, I wait as the hour ticks by until my phone strikes noon.

My palms begin to sweat and I feel butterflies of excitement flutter in my stomach.

After all these years, my family is finally going to be together.As I smooth down my shirt, the voices suddenly start up again.

"He’s here! He's here!"

They cry.I look up and spot a beautiful older woman holding a little boy’s hand in hers.

The child has his back to me but I can see he wears overalls and bright blue vans as he skips happily towards the washroom.

Rising to my feet, I linger over to a small shop near the washroom to get a better look and wait patiently for them to come out.

The voices fall silent when I see the little boy, my son, face to face for the first time.

His eyes are mesmerizing with their brown and blue irises, a thick pair of lashes casting a shadow on his cheeks.He has my pale skin and small lips but his nose is all Natalia’s.He’s perfect, I smile to myself, the little boy blinking up at the older woman.
